O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910. 176(b): Bags, containers, bundles, etc., stored in tiers were not stacked, blocked, interlocked and limited in height so that they are stable and secure against sliding or collapse: On or about October 07, 2019, and at times prior thereto, at a workplace located at 602 US 287 Frontage Road, Mansfield, Texas; the employer did not block and limit height of stored product boxes to prevent falling, sliding and/or collapsing.

General-duty citation text
CFR 1910. 178(l)(1)(i): The employer did not ensure that each powered industrial truck operator is competent to operate a powered industrial truck safely, as demonstrated by the successful completion of the training and evaluation specified in this paragraph (l): On or about October 07, 2019, and at times prior thereto, at a workplace located at 602 US 287 Frontage Road, Mansfield, Texas; the employer did not provide training to power stocker operators to ensure employees were competent to operate the powered industrial truck safely exposing employees to struck by hazards.
